Christine McGuinness can't wait for 2020 to come to an end and get back to socialising with friends and family. This year has been tough for Christine and her comedian husband Paddy because their three autistic children have struggled with lockdowns and being cooped up indoors, so she can't wait to get out and about with them next year.With school and nursery closures, the most challenging aspect has been caring for twins Leo and Penelope, seven, and Felicity, three.She said to Daily Star: "With 2021 in sight I think like everyone else we are excited about leaving this year behind.“I definitely want to see more of the world.
